Westside Regional Medical Center (WRMC) is pleased to announce the appointments of Lee B. Chaykin as CEO, Kathleen Morris as VP of Regulatory Compliance, and Tim O’Brien as the Facility’s Assistant Administrator.
 
Chaykin has more than 22 years of healthcare finance and management experience, and has been with HCA for the past 20 years. He comes to Westside from Kendall Regional Medical Center where he served as the Chief Executive Officer. Prior to his most recent position, Chaykin was at University Hospital and Medical Center in Tamarac where he had also served as the CEO since 2007.
 
Most recently Morris served as HCA – East Florida Division’s Ethics and Compliance Officer. Previous to this experience she was the VP of Quality Management at Aventura Hospital and Medical Center in Aventura for 13 years. Morris was also the Director of Quality Management for Miami Heart Institute in Miami Beach for two years. Prior to her time at Miami Heart she held the position of Administrative Director of Quality Management for St. Mary’s and Good Samaritan Hospitals in Palm Beach for over nine years.
 
O’Brien began his career in healthcare with Arthur Anderson Business Consulting as a Healthcare Consultant in 1999. By 2002 he had been promoted to the position of Senior Healthcare Consultant with the firm. From 2002 to 2006 O’Brien worked as a Manger for Navigant Consulting. He started with HCA in 2006 as a Director of the Company’s Strategic Resource Group (SRG). In 2010 he was promoted to the Senior Director position at SRG.
